HELP US stop the tram

To the Speaker and Members of the Legislative Assembly for the Australian Capital Territory

This petition of residents of the Australian Capital Territory draws to the attention of the Assembly the following: 


  • The tram caused over $400 million to be ripped out of hospitals, and nearly  $90 million from road funding. 
  • Rates have increased at record levels.
  • The ACT has a critical teacher shortage, longest hospital waiting times in Australia, lowest number of police per capita and massive debt.
  • Trams are much slower than existing buses, and electric buses are more affordable and environmentally friendly. 
  • The funding could be better spent on better hospitals, better roads, more police and better schools.


Your petitioners therefore request the Assembly to call on the Government to:


1. Stop Light Rail Project 2B.


SPONSORED BY JEREMY HANSON MLA
